    I've had a few interactions with this company that were very unprofessional. I have my puppy go to their doggy daycare and he loves it, it's close to the house and convenient. I've also done the puppy obedience class and it was very good.
    I brought my then 8month old puppy to daycare as I was working that whole week. He is around the age they request neutering and I already had an appointment scheduled. They called to tell me that he had started humping and that he was not allowed back until he was fixed. I told them I already had an appointment for neutering but they again stated he wasn't welcome back until it was done. It left me with a huge dilemma as I had no where to bring him and I was working this week.
    The second issue, my dog is now 11months and they called to tell me he was aggressively attacking other dogs when they come in and out of the door. I spoke to their trainer who told me this was normal for this age and I should enroll him in a class to help fix this behavior. I called my own trainer who gave me some things to do at home and I also scheduled time with her to show me what I need to do. My trainer asked me to call the facility and see if they could also do this at doggy daycare as it would help to be reinforced in both places. The person I spoke to was extremely rude and very difficult to talk to and kept telling me that he would not be welcome back if it wasn't fixed. This is an 11 month old puppy and they work with dogs. I'm not a trainer or a dog expert and they spoke to me like I was an idiot, not an educated adult. It's ok, I'll work on it with him that night but I had to bring him in the next day because I had to work.
    They called again and my husband called back and the person claimed they were an owner of the facility and wouldn't let my husband talk at all, said my puppy wasn't allowed back and told him to "F-off"! This is a place that deals with dogs for a living but cannot manage a puppy or work with the owners at all.
